			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Bedroom is the part of the house where we can sleep, relax and be worry free. And to make this happen, you need invest in a good bed as well as a good mattress.  And here are some practical tips that can be very useful if you are shopping for bed frame and mattress.</p>
<p>Bed frames have different sizes. The size ranges from single which typically measure 36&#215;75 feet. There&#8217;s twin bed which measures 48&#215;75 inches. Next is Queen size which is 54 inches by 75 inches and the last one is king size which usually measures 75&#215;78. inches. The length of bed is mostly 75 inches but in some countries it can go to as long as 78 inches and 80 inches. The sizes of single bed to queen size are standards in most country where as king size differs from different countries. California king size bed is  the largest measuring 72 inches by 84 inches.</p>
<p>When choosing bed frame, you have to consider your size and how you sleep. If you sleep like a log and never moves while sleeping, then a twin sized bed is ideal for you. But if you&#8217;re a mover, you may want to opt for a queen sized bed or a king sized. It follows that when buying the mattress for your bed frames it should be of the same size. Now the only thing you need to consider is the type of mattress that you will buy. Will you go for a spring mattress or foam mattress and how thick it should be. Deciding on the type of mattress is again up to your sleeping patter.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Rattan is a non timber forest product that is widely used in furniture making and basket weaving. The Philippine Agriculture is trying to do whatever it can to produce more rattan as to have an abundance supply of raw materials to furniture makers.</p>
<p>Rattan is very common in Asia and in Australia.</p>
<p>Rattan bear fruits and it is edible. So aside form its use on the furniture industry, it can also be eaten. The Rattan fruit is round and brown in color. Th fruit inside is also brown with seeds. And the taste, oh super sour!!</p>
